Bank of America CEO: U.S. consumer spending remains strong, industry ready for deregulation
Brian Moynihan, chief executive of Bank of America, said US consumers continued to spend while the banking industry was preparing for regulatory changes that would allow banks to enter industries they would otherwise have to avoid. "These rules are difficult for institutions to comply with because of the reputational risk involved, which is usually identified in retrospect... If these rules were changed, there would be no such drawback."
